A reverse mortgage specialist in Rancho Cucamonga helps homeowners aged 62 and older convert part of their home equity into cash. Under California law borrowers must receive counseling from a HUD approved agency before applying. This service is useful for seniors in San Bernardino County who want to supplement retirement income without selling their home.
What Does a Reverse Mortgage Specialist in Rancho Cucamonga Cost?
In California a reverse mortgage specialist may charge a flat fee or a percentage of the loan amount. Typical costs include an origination fee from 0 to 2 percent of the home value plus third party fees for appraisal title and recording. For a home worth 500000 dollars total closing costs often range from 5000 to 15000 dollars. This is general information and not mortgage or financial advice.

What does a reverse mortgage specialist do in Rancho Cucamonga?
A reverse mortgage specialist explains loan options such as the Home Equity Conversion Mortgage or HECM. They help you understand eligibility requirements and guide you through the application process. They do not provide financial advice but can refer you to a HUD approved counselor.
Are there California specific rules for reverse mortgages?
Yes California requires a three day right of rescission after you sign loan documents. Also the borrower must complete counseling with a HUD approved agency before the loan can proceed. These rules protect seniors from making hasty decisions.
How much does it cost to work with a reverse mortgage specialist in California?
Specialists typically do not charge a fee for initial consultations. If you proceed with a loan the specialist may be paid through lender fees which can range from 0 to 2 percent of the loan amount. Always ask about all costs before signing.
